How should society treat criminals and their victims? Ann Leslie of the Daily Mail, documentary maker Roger Graef and former prisoner Jonathan Aitken join Michael Portillo.

Eric Valli's Oscar-nominated odyssey. Thilen Lhondup plays a Nepalese trader relying on traditional wisdom to get his herd across inhospitable terrain. In Tibetan with English subtitles. Widescreen.
